“You’re not going to race him with 50k to go and he’s doing seven watts a kilo" - Geraint Thomas explains why bunch don't follow Pogacar attacks

Pogacar’s seven‑watts‑per‑kilogram surge with 50 km to go leaves rivals staring at a power gap only a few can match.

Where it stands

Pogacar is sustaining seven watts per kilogram with 50 km left, a level Geraint Thomas says “you’re not going to race him … and he’s doing seven watts a kilo.” The figure comes as the Vuelta a España reaches its final mountain stages, and it explains why the peloton is reluctant to match his attacks. Riders and team directors must decide whether to chase or conserve energy.

Such output rivals elite climbers and forces teams to recalibrate their pacing plans. Escape Collective points to the UAE team’s humility as rivals search for clues, while Outside Magazine notes Pogacar’s razor‑thin time‑trial wins over rivals like Van der Poel and Hayter.

Cyclingnews supplies live‑stream details for fans. The next Vuelta stages will test if any rider can break his power advantage.
